Owner Profile:
05/11/17 16:35
Basic information:
Poof is an 11 yr. old female domestic short hair mix. The owner surrendered Poof she moved to a place that does not allow pets. Poof has no health problems and the owner last took her to a vet over 8 years ago.
Socialization:
The owner states that around strangers Poof is friendly and outgoing. Poof has lived with two children ages 5 to 14 and is gentle and loves to play. Poof has lived with 3 other cats and got along well with them (they would eat sleep and play together). Poof has never bitten or scratched anyone.
Behavior:
Poof has never been bathed, had her nails trimmed. She does not mind having her coat brushed, being picked up but struggles when being placed in a cat carrier.
For a new family to know:
The owner describes Poof as friendly cat with a medium activity level. Poof has never played with toys; she lives mostly indoors and sleeps anywhere in the house that he wants. In the home Poof will follow the owner around and prefers to stay in same room as the owner. Poof eats various name brand dry cat foods and is feed two times a day. She is litter box trained and uses an uncovered litter box with clumping litter. Poof has never been given a scratching post so the owner does not know if he will use it or not.
Behavior during intake:
During intake Poof was somewhat tense with stiff body, she allowed us to put on collar, photograph and placed in a cat kennel.
